A Quality Consultant is a specialized professional who works within the quality control industry to ensure that a business' products, services, and internal processes meet established standards of quality. They are primarily responsible for evaluating and auditing an organization's processes, providing guidance and recommendations for improvement, assessing risks, and driving the implementation of quality management systems. They also perform training and development for the company's employees to understand and comply with quality standards. These consultants may also be involved in developing, implementing, and reviewing quality control policies and procedures.
Key skills for a Quality Consultant include analytical thinking, excellent communication and interpersonal skills, problem-solving abilities, and profound knowledge of quality control standards and procedures. They should also have a comprehensive understanding of project management and statistical analysis techniques. Quality Consultants should ideally possess certifications such as Certified Quality Engineer (CQE), Certified Manager of Quality (CMQ), or Certified Six Sigma Black Belt (CSSBB). Prior to becoming a Quality Consultant, individuals might have roles such as a Quality Control Analyst, Quality Assurance Specialist, or Quality Manager in manufacturing, engineering, or other industries where quality control is vital.
